What it is
Moisture Shadow that moisturizes the eyes while shining Orange x Matte Red A combination of shimmery orange and vibrant, chic matte red that brings vital beauty to the eyes POINT 1 Pressed with beautifully shining minerals as beauty ingredients Bio Moisture Shadow is a unique wet-formulation method that solidifies the product without using unnecessary binders so that the natural ingredients contained in the product can be utilized without compromising them. Formulated only with "mineral powder," "natural pigments," and "plant beauty ingredients," this oil-rich pressed type product thoroughly moisturizes the eye area. By incorporating beauty ingredients, we were able to make the texture creamy and the skin moist and soft. The creamy texture enhances the sparkle and color of the eyes, resulting in a transparent finish. POINT 2 Moisturizing and anti-aging care with fruit oils Based on olive squalane , which has a similar structure to the moisturizing ingredient "squalane" that exists in the skin but tends to be lost with age, it contains beauty fruit oils that provide anti-aging care. Acai oil, which is attracting attention as a super fruit, and rosehip oil, which is full of vitamins, deliver moisture. Chamomile oil, which gives skin firmness, also leads to smooth and elastic eye area. Due to makeup effect Cosmetic care according to age Squalane Acai palm fruit oil Rosehip oil Roman chamomile flower oil. 6 moisturizing ingredients.
Ingredients
Matte Red: Mica, squalane, vegetable oil, kaolin, silica, Roman chamomile flower oil, eucalyptus fruit oil, cranberry seed oil, rosa canina fruit oil, titanium dioxide, iron oxide, aluminum hydroxide, carmine Orange: Mica, squalane, vegetable oil, kaolin, silica, Roman chamomile flower oil, eucalyptus fruit oil, cranberry seed oil, rosa canina fruit oil, titanium dioxide, iron oxide, aluminum hydroxide, carmine
How to use
1. Blend the tightening color from the edge of the eye to about 2/3 of the way down the eyelid. 2. Apply the base color over the tightening color, layering it from the border of the base color to the entire eyelid.
